History of the Festival:

The World Table Tennis for Health Festival (WTT4HF) was developed in response to the increasing enthusiasm surrounding the ITTF Parkinson’s World Table Tennis Championships in 2019 and 2021, and the desire to showcase the wider health benefits of sport—particularly for individuals living with neurodegenerative diseases. The Festival highlights the positive impact of table tennis not only for people affected by specific conditions but also as a tool for preventing illness, staying active, and promoting overall well-being. This aligns with the broader mission and continued investment of the ITTF Group and ITTF Foundation in using table tennis as a force for health.

Past and Upcoming Editions:

  • 2025 Festival: Helsingborg, Sweden
  • 2024 Festival: Maizières-lès-Metz, France
  • 2023 Festival: Crete, Greece
  • 2021 WPTTC: Berlin, Germany
  • 2019 WPTTC: New York, USA

Key highlights:

  • A historic high of 153 participants joined the 2024 Festival in France.
  • Participants from all 5 continents competed at the 2023 World Parkinson’s Table Tennis Championships (WPTTC) in Greece.
  • In 2022, the ITTF Foundation won Gold for ‘Best Sport Governing Body Initiative’ for organising the WPTTC (4 editions have been held to date).
  • In 2023 in Greece, the festival championships as well as the congress was broadcasted live on YouTube with live views of more than 8,000.
  • The World Table Tennis for Health Congress featured esteemed global speakers and institutions, including the World Health Organisation (WHO).
